Transaction 9388394c04f61f2ee96fe5f7a80db6723b357d583b743468809dcd6fdb692410
1 Input
1 Output
-
9388394c04f61f2ee96fe5f7a80db6723b357d583b743468809dcd6fdb692410:0
- value
- 2025575
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3383b700ca5aa831b03a1da4e4e0bcb63f6a51e OP_EQUAL
- address
- 3Lwqs6mRd3iViz3qKsrBobVACKfkbHnJfq